Abstract
本公开实施例公开了一种显示面板及显示装置,该显示面板包括:衬底基板,低温多晶硅半导体层,氧化物半导体层,源漏金属层,弯折区域对应的源漏金属层设置有多条沿第一方向延伸且沿第二方向排列的相互绝缘的走线,显示区域对应的源漏金属层设置有多条沿第一方向延伸且沿第二方向排列的相互绝缘的信号线;走线上的信号包括由低温多晶硅半导体层所在晶体管传输的信号以及由氧化物半导体层所在晶体管传输的信号;无机层,位于衬底基板和源漏金属层之间,无机层在弯折区域设置有凹槽,凹槽上方设置有走线;柔性绝缘材料,位于弯折区域的无机层和走线之间,柔性绝缘材料填充凹槽。
